From the real-life Kokomo to the sandy shores of our walk-in beach, it’s no wonder why Postcard Inn Beach Resort & Marina is a Florida Keys favorite and voted "Top 10 Resort in the Florida Keys" in Conde Nast Traveler (2022). Located 90 minutes from Miami, our oceanfront resort has been serving up iconic cocktails and nostalgic beach vibes since 1951. Wake up on the sunrise side of Islamorada for a day filled with watersports, waterfront dining, and all-day fun. Resort guests also receive access to all four Islamorada Resorts.

Not altogether bad, but if you are looking for a relaxing place to chill out this is not it. The Postcard Inn comes up as one of the resorts on TripAdvisor when you search for "Adults Only resorts in the Florida Keys" but this is decidedly NOT for adults only. There are plenty of families with young children and teens. There was also a contingent of rowdy young 30-something single men in attendance, which seemed to be associated with the fact that this is also a marina for sport fishing boats. Loud music is piped throughout the public areas all day and evening. So you can imagine how far from peaceful the environment is. We were woken our first morning there at 7:00am by maintenance crews very loudly power-washing the walkways outside our room. Couldn't wait until 9:00? Guess not. Bring a towel from your room if you want to swim in the pool – they run out of towels quickly at the pool cabana. But be advised that the pool area is an attraction for little kids, who tend to vocalize loudly and constantly. The food: meh. The raw bar and Tiki Bar have the same limited menu, so don't expect anything special. This is evidently not a non-smoking property. We often had to put up with cigar smoke and pot smoke wafting up toward our room balcony. If you work at it you can find a few relatively quiet places on the premises. We found one that was away from the noise on our last day but were asked to leave after a couple of hours due to a wedding event that was scheduled in that area. And of course you can always retreat to your room, but then what's the point of going to a tropical resort if you're only going to hole up in your room? Probably great for families with children, but not for adults looking for a serene vacation.

Positives: Location right on beach was wonderful, had a handy marina next door, where manetees and tarpon came which you can feed etc. Negatives: Felt the reception staff not very friendly maybe because we were British, the hotel is expensive over $600 per night for a bog standard room, so you expect good service. We stayed for 3 nights, the housekeeper only cleaned on 1 night, and we had to complain as room they gave us was near the road and we had a balcony that 2 feet away were palm trees very dark and dingy. They moved us to room over marina which had a good outlook. .Very pricey for food and drink (this is perhaps the keys and not just this hotel), again service could be better they look under resourced. They shut the main pool for 1 day while we were there was had to go to their sister hotel to use Pool on beach, not overly happy about this.
